$40 million Series B funding secured to expedite the adoption of autonomous mushroom harvesting.
2025-08-11 00:00
4AG Robotics has closed its $40 million CAD Series B financing, led by Astanor and Cibus Capital, with support from new investor Voyager Capital and existing investors InBC, Emmertech, BDC Industrial Innovation Fund, Jim Richardson Family Office, and Stray Dog Capital. This round follows a $17.5 million CAD Series A financing.

The campaign for prickly pears promises a plentiful harvest of the Agostano variety.
2025-08-11 00:00
A significant amount of large-sized fruit is anticipated for the early prickly pear harvest, which is scheduled to start in the first week of August. Normal quantities are projected for the late harvest, referred to as the "bastardone," with marketing set to commence in September. The "bastardone" is a fruit that is obtained.

Gros (Selex): in Guidonia, the 30,000 square meter logistics hub.
2025-08-09 00:00
Inaugurated on July 6th, the new logistics center Cedi Gros - Maestri del Fresco (Selex) was built in Guidonia (Rome), near the Car (Centro Agroalimentare Roma), and is intended to receive and distribute the freshest products, covering a total area of 30,000 square meters.

"Bloom Fresh wygrywa sprawę praw do odmian roślin"
2025-08-08 09:00
One of the world's leading breeders of table grapes, cherries, and blueberries, Bloom Fresh, has won a plant variety rights (PVR) case in China, resulting in the destruction of illegally propagated IFG Ten vines sold to consumers as Sweet Globe.
